[VBA ] goto用法

看板Visual_Basic作者 (信箱爆炸..XD)時間15年前 (2010/06/25 12:07), 編輯推噓2(203)
留言5則, 2人參與, 最新討論串1/4 (看更多)
for i=1 to 10 for j= 1 to 10 /這邊要寫的的是,假設j大於某個數(每次都不一樣) 則剩下的j迴圈就不跑了,直接跳到下一個i. next j next i (我該如何寫才可以讓程式跳到這一行) 感謝,不知道我這樣表達,是否有不清楚的地方。 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 140.112.35.104

06/25 12:59, , 1F
if...then exit for..end if
06/25 12:59, 1F

06/25 13:04, , 2F
注意exit for這行要寫在 j 的這個循環的循環體內。
06/25 13:04, 2F

06/25 13:04, , 3F
re 1樓︰ 若在同一行內可以不用尾巴的 end if 吧。
06/25 13:04, 3F

06/25 13:18, , 4F
樓上提議很好..但是我剛試了...VBA不能寫在同一行.....XD
06/25 13:18, 4F

06/25 13:23, , 5F
我了解O大的意思了.. if {..} then exit for 這樣就可以了..
06/25 13:23, 5F
文章代碼(AID): #1C92jcwU (Visual_Basic)
討論串 (同標題文章)
以下文章回應了本文
完整討論串 (本文為第 1 之 4 篇):
3
5
2
4
2
5
文章代碼(AID): #1C92jcwU (Visual_Basic)